No. 3 Arizona vs. Utah: Preview, TV schedule, start time and more

The Wildcats look to improve to 14-0 on Saturday against an improving Pac-12 foe.

Casey Sapio-USA TODAY Sports

After escaping with an overtime win over Colorado on Thursday night, the Arizona Wildcats will have a quick turnaround against Utah. The 'Cats and Utes are set to square off on Saturday afternoon, which will give UA a chance to get out to a 2-0 start in conference play.

While Arizona had problems with CU, they should have their way against Utah. They're coming off a tough one-point loss to Arizona State, and while coach Larry Krystkowiak has the program headed in the right direction, they still lack abundant talent and playmakers on the roster.

Utah's leading scorers are Jarred DuBois and Jordan Loveridge, who both average about 13 points a night. As a team, the Utes shoot 46 percent from the floor, 37 percent from behind the 3-point arc and 76 percent at the free throw line. The biggest advantage for coach Krystkowiak will be rest; Utah last played on Wednesday, so they should be refreshed and ready to go in front of what is expected to be a sold out McKale Center.
